11-11 Feed-forward Function
The feed-forward function come in 2 types: speed feed-forward and torque feed-forward.
The speed feed-forward can minimize the position error and increase the responsiveness
during position or fully-closed control.
Responsiveness is improved by adding the speed feed-forward value calculated from the
internal position command and related objects (3110 hex and 3111 hex) to the speed
command calculated by comparing the internal position command and the position feedback.
If the Velocity offset (60B1 hex) is set, both the set value and the speed feed-forward valued
are added to the Control effort (60FA hex).
The torque feed-forward can increase the responsiveness of the speed control system.
Responsiveness is improved by adding the torque feed-forward value calculated from the
Control effort (60FA hex) and related objects (3112 hex and 3113 hex) to the torque command
calculated by comparing the Control effort (60FA hex) and the speed feedback.
If the Torque offset (60B2 hex) is set, both the set value and the torque feed-forward valued
are added to the torque command.
Objects Requiring Settings
Index Name Description Reference
3110 hex Speed Feed-forward Gain
The speed command from position control
processing is added to the product of the Control
effort (60FA hex) that is calculated from the internal
position command times the ratio in this object.
page 9-9
3111 hex
Speed Feed-forward
Command Filter
Set the time constant for the first-order lag filter that
is applied to speed feed-forward input.
page 9-10
3112 hex Torque Feed-forward Gain
The torque command from speed control
processing is added to the product of the Control
effort (60FA hex) times the ratio in this object.
page 9-10
3113 hex
Torque Feed-forward
Command Filter
Set the time constant for the first-order lag filter that
is applied to torque feed-forward input.
page 9-10
60B1 hex Velocity offset
Set the offset for the speed command.
It will be added to the Control effort (60FA hex).
page 6-45
60B2 hex Torque offset
Set the offset for the torque command.
It will be added to the torque command value.
page 6-46
